King of Swords Tarot Card Description

The King of Swords is a symbol of intellectual power and authority and has the courage and intellect to achieve all that he desires. He sits upon his throne, facing forward, indicative of the direct approach he takes in all matters. In his hand, he holds a double-edged sword, symbolic of his ability to use both force and fairness to make decisions. His robe is decorated with butterflies and clouds, which represent transformation and abstract thought, while the clear sky symbolizes clarity of thought.

Upright King of Swords Meaning

"Lead with intelligence and integrity, communicate your vision with clarity, and make decisions based on fairness and justice."

The King of Swords represents intellectual power and authority and has the courage and intellect to achieve all that he desires. This card suggests using your intellect to navigate through life's challenges. The King of Swords encourages you to use clear, logical thinking and to remain impartial, calling for fairness in all your decisions.

Upright - Love

In matters of the heart, the King of Swords suggests a rational and methodical approach to relationships. Communicate clearly and don't be afraid to speak your truth. It might also indicate a person who is erudite and eloquent.

Upright - Career

The King of Swords denotes a powerful leader who is fair and analytical. He advises you to take a strategic approach at work. Craft your career with keen intellect and ethical action.

Upright - Finances

When it comes to finances, this card suggests the need for logical and strategic planning. Make sure to manage your money with a clear mind and avoid any financial decisions based on emotions.

Upright - Health

The King of Swords offers a reminder to think logically about your health. It encourages seeking expert advice and carefully considering the options for any treatments or health decisions.

Upright - Spirituality

Spiritually, the King of Swords calls you to seek wisdom and understanding. Study and intellectually engage with spiritual concepts to expand your perspectives.

Reversed King of Swords Meaning

In its reversed position, the King of Swords warns of potential abuse of intellectual power and manipulation. It suggests that you may encounter someone who is overly authoritarian or manipulative, or you may need to examine your own behaviors in this light.

Reversed - Love

Reversed, the King of Swords can indicate a lack of clarity and fairness in communication within relationships. It may be a sign of dishonesty or manipulative behavior.

Reversed - Career

When the King of Swords is reversed in a career context, it might signal the presence of an overbearing authority figure, or suggest that you're not using your intellectual capabilities fully.

Reversed - Finances

The King of Swords reversed advises caution in financial dealings. It warns against making impulsive decisions and suggests taking a step back to reassess your financial strategy objectively.

Reversed - Health

In a health reading, the reversed King of Swords suggests you may not be seeing the full picture regarding your health. There is a need for a second opinion or to look more critically at health advice received.

Reversed - Spirituality

Spiritually, the reversed King of Swords can mean that you are engaging in overly critical thinking or skepticism that may be hindering your spiritual growth. It may be time to open your mind to new ideas.
